Join National Gas as an Operations Technician and help maintain the systems and infrastructure that keep Britain's gas transmission network operating safely and reliably.
We're looking for people with experience in Electrical, Instrumentation, Control Systems, Operational Technology, or Cyber environments. You'll support critical operational assets across the network, helping to improve reliability, resolve faults, and protect the systems that underpin our operations.
Our operational sites play a vital role in transporting gas across the country. Keeping these assets performing safely, securely, and reliably is essential to network performance and energy security.
This is a varied, hands-on role where you'll work across maintenance, fault finding, system improvements, and operational technology. Whether your background is Electrical, Instrumentation, Automation, or Cyber, you'll have the opportunity to broaden your technical expertise while supporting critical national infrastructure.
Maintain electrical, instrumentation, control, and operational technology assets across multiple operational sites
Diagnose faults and restore equipment performance to support reliable network operations
Support the maintenance and improvement of PLC, SCADA, control, and industrial network systems
Carry out inspections, testing, and planned maintenance activities
Support the implementation of operational technology and cyber security controls
Collaborate with contractors, engineers, and specialist teams to deliver safe and effective solutions
Participate in a standby rota following training
This role would suit someone who enjoys hands-on technical work, solving problems, and working in a field-based operational environment.
Experience in Electrical Engineering, Instrumentation, Control Systems, Operational Technology, Automation, or Cyber-related environments
Strong fault-finding and diagnostic skills
Ability to interpret engineering drawings, schematics, or technical documentation
Experience working with industrial equipment, control systems, or operational assets
Strong focus on safety, reliability, and engineering standards
Ability to work independently and manage work across multiple locations
Full UK driving licence
Experience with PLC, SCADA, instrumentation, industrial control, or network systems
Knowledge of Operational Technology (OT) or industrial cyber security principles
Experience working within utilities, manufacturing, process industries, or critical infrastructure
Electrical, Instrumentation, Engineering, or related technical qualification
Experience participating in a standby rota
